The F1 Quiz – New Circuits
F1 is off to the Buddh International Circuit this weekend but since this is our first visit to India there’s little I can ask about the event. Fear not however, for I have a cunning plan: ten questions on the inaguaral events at the last circuits to have joined the F1 calendar. From Albert Park in 1996 through to Yeongam in 2010 I’ve a question for you on each new event… how much do you remember about them?
1. Albert Park, 1996. A spectacular first lap accident saw this drivers car split in two. Name the driver and the team he drove for.
2. Sepang, 1999. Ferrari were disqualified for running a controversial aerodynamic device at this inagural event, which piece of aero had the stewards upset?
3. Bahrain, 2004. Which driver knocked over a couple of his pit crew during a pit stop?
4. Shanghai, 2004. Which driver made his first appearance of the season at this circuit and for which team did he drive?


5. Istanbul Park, 2005. Which team’s drivers had problems with rear right punctures during the race?
6. Valencia Street Circuit, 2008. Who was the title sponsor for the European GP?
7. Marina Bay, 2008. Which team abandoned using their electronic traffic light release system after an unsafe release from the pit?
8. 2009, Yas Marina. This driver pulled into the wrong team’s pit garaage, who was he?
9. 2010, Yeongam. Who retired from leading the race when his engine failed?
10. 2011, Greater Noida. Which driver holds the honour of being the first to drive an F1 car around a lap of the Buddh International Circuit?
